Nestled in the Rocky Mountains, the Crownest Pass is one of the best-kept vacation secrets in Canada. The area is rich in history, recreational and outdoor activities. Museums and cultural centers offer visitors a glimpse into the dramatic history of the region.

Breathtaking mountain tops fill the skyline, natural vegetation blankets the valleys and waterfalls and mountain streams cascade into lakes, rivers and creeks. The natural beauty of this area makes it one of the best wildlife observation and fishing areas in Canada while its rugged landscape offers world-renowned adventure opportunities, winter, summer, spring and fall.

The Crownest Pass boasts an unparalleled natural year-round “playground” for visitors of all ages and interests, from snowmobiling to golf, sightseeing to festivals. With its affordable modern amenities and exciting events, the Crownest Pass is the perfect place to visit, any time of the year.
